要使ECShop首页中新品上市的商品下面出现购买和收藏两个按钮,您需要对模板文件进行一些修改,以下是实现这个功能的步骤:
1、找到模板文件:找到显示商品列表的模板文件,通常在themes
目录下的某个主题文件夹中,如果您使用的是默认的主题,那么文件可能在themes/default/catalog/
目录中。
2、编辑模板文件:打开对应的模板文件,通常是goods_list.dwt
或类似的文件。
3、添加按钮代码:在商品列表循环(通常是{foreach from=$goods item}
)中添加购买和收藏按钮的代码,您可以使用ECShop自带的按钮样式和功能。
以下是一个示例代码片段,假设您正在编辑goods_list.dwt
文件:
<!-在适当位置插入这段代码 --> {foreach from=$goods item} <div class="goods-item"> <!-其他商品信息展示代码 --> <div class="buttons"> <a href="{$item.url}" title="{$lang.goods_detail}" class="btn btn-buy">购买</a> <a href="javascript:;" onclick="addToFavorite('{$item.goods_id}')" title="{$lang.favorite_add}" class="btn btn-favorite">收藏</a> </div> </div> {/foreach}
4、定义收藏功能:如果收藏功能未启用或没有相应的JavaScript函数,您需要在页面中添加一个用于处理收藏逻辑的JavaScript函数。
<script type="text/javascript"> function addToFavorite(goodsId) { // 这里可以添加您的收藏逻辑,比如发送Ajax请求到后端 alert('商品已添加到收藏夹'); } </script>
5、更新CSS样式:确保按钮样式与页面整体风格一致,如果需要,可以在CSS文件中添加相应的样式。
6、保存并刷新页面:保存您所做的更改,然后刷新ECShop首页以查看效果。
通过以上步骤,您应该能够在ECShop首页中的新品上市商品下看到购买和收藏两个按钮,请根据您的具体需求和模板结构进行调整。